Output 17d21c24b6107a02a8056f124e3a4f4fed3fc9a897e21fcc7519f750ce983b91:0

value
4476464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f5d75b629d817ea89bc0d58ee9b8b4237de4d35 OP_EQUAL
address
38vfGQ9NUtjg6LDsbkyHdHpArW8bXv9FH2
transaction
17d21c24b6107a02a8056f124e3a4f4fed3fc9a897e21fcc7519f750ce983b91
spent
true